
Analog multiplier IC for precision signal processing. Features a 1MHz -3dB bandwidth and 2% accuracy. Operates with dual supply voltages from ±8V to ±18V, consuming 6mA typical operating current. Surface mountable in a SOIC package with tin-matte contact plating. Suitable for applications requiring multiplication of analog signals, with a settling time of 2µs and a slew rate of 20V/µs.
